        Office space social network users ‘need to be wary’

          Businesses owners need to make sure that any employees using social media websites in the office space are wary of cyber threats.

          According to internet security specialist Norton, cybercriminals are increasingly targeting social networking websites in order to exploit the trust people have in them.

          Dan Nadir, senior director of consumer products at Norton said: “What we’ve noticed more recently is that cybercriminals are building threats that are designed to trick social network users.”

          “The bad guys have realised that people are much more likely to trust a link or attachment that a friend or family member has sent them, and they are exploiting that trust,” he added.

          He concluded that as well as affecting people’s personal finances, victims of cybercriminals can become part of the problem as their profiles can be used to infect other social network users.

          In February, Norton launched its Cybercrime Index as a means of raising awareness of the issue of social media threats.
